What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a no experience motion graphics designer?

To thrive as a No Experience Motion Graphics Designer, you should have a basic understanding of design principles, creativity, and a willingness to learn new techniques, often with a portfolio showcasing personal or school projects rather than professional work. Familiarity with industry-standard software such as Adobe After Effects, Adobe Premiere Pro, and Photoshop is highly valuable, and online certifications or tutorials can help demonstrate your commitment to the craft. Attention to detail, strong communication skills, and the ability to accept and act on feedback will help you excel in a collaborative environment. These abilities are crucial for producing visually engaging content and adapting quickly in a fast-paced, team-oriented industry.

How to start a career in motion graphics design?

To start a career as a motion graphics designer, learn relevant software such as Adobe After Effects and Adobe Premiere Pro, build a portfolio with personal or freelance projects, and gain foundational knowledge in design principles and animation. Gaining experience through online tutorials, courses, or internships can also help develop skills and improve employability.

What are some challenges a no experience motion graphics designer might face in their first role?

As a No Experience Motion Graphics Designer, you may initially find it challenging to keep up with the fast pace of project revisions and tight deadlines commonly found in media and creative agencies. You might also encounter a learning curve with industry-standard software and adapting your style to match client or company branding guidelines. However, most teams provide mentorship or training to help integrate new designers, and feedback sessions are common to help you grow your skills quickly. With a proactive approach to learning and open communication with team members, you’ll be able to overcome these early challenges and develop your portfolio as you gain experience.

What is a no experience motion graphics designer?

A No Experience Motion Graphics Designer job is an entry-level position for individuals new to motion graphics. It typically involves creating simple animations, visual effects, and design elements for videos, advertisements, or social media. Employers may provide training, expecting candidates to have basic knowledge of design software like Adobe After Effects. Strong creativity, willingness to learn, and a portfolio of personal or academic projects can help candidates stand out.

Are motion graphics designers in demand?

Motion graphics designers are in demand as visual content becomes increasingly important for marketing, advertising, and digital media. Skills in software like Adobe After Effects and a strong portfolio can improve job prospects, especially in creative agencies and media companies.

Is it hard to get a job in motion graphics?

Securing a job as a motion graphics designer can be competitive, especially without experience, but building a strong portfolio and mastering tools like Adobe After Effects and Cinema 4D can improve chances. Entry-level roles often require demonstrating creativity, technical skills, and a willingness to learn, with some positions offering on-the-job training.
